After seeing the Enforcer thread I wondered if anyone had any stories or photos of Enfields in BritishPolice use? This clip is a 2001 look back at the murder of PC George Russell by John Middleton at Oxenholme Station. The original 1965 footage shows more Enfield Rifles
but I cant find it on line. Of the 3 Police officers that were sent to Oxenholme station, George Russell died as a result of his injuries, Pc Alex Archibald was shot in the head and suffered in constant pain untill Nov 2012 when he passed away from cancer and the Inspector was later promoted and and joined the firearms department. He unfortunatly took his own life with a service revolver at the Police Station due to his wife passing of cancer.

My farthers best friend Geoff Harrington disarmed Middleton after he was shot in the leg by another Police man, Geoff received a MBE in the early 1990s for his action in 1965.
